.NET Developer Job Trends

.NET Developer
UK

The median .NET Developer salary in the UK is £63,750 per year, according to job vacancies posted during the 6 months leading to 2 March 2026.

The table below compares current salary benchmarking and summary statistics with the previous two years.

6 months to
2 Mar 2026
Same period 2025 Same period 2024
Rank 341 263 89
Rank change year-on-year -78 -174 +91
Permanent jobs requiring a .NET Developer 386 544 2,359
As % of all permanent jobs in the UK 0.55% 1.17% 3.00%
As % of the Job Titles category 0.60% 1.29% 3.17%
Number of salaries quoted 356 428 2,277
10th Percentile £45,000 £32,500 £39,000
25th Percentile £50,000 £43,750 £45,000
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£63,750 £55,000 £57,500
Median % change year-on-year +15.91% -4.35% -
75th Percentile £80,000 £71,250 £70,000
90th Percentile £100,000 £94,125 £87,500
UK excluding London median annual salary £60,000 £52,500 £55,000
% change year-on-year +14.29% -4.55% +4.76%
